On Tue, 30 Nov 2004, Jeffrey Lim wrote:

> hi folks, i am having problems with a usb mouse driver i'm trying to
> write, as the system somehow keeps on assigning the 'hid' driver to
> the mouse no matter what i do, even if my driver is ~specifically~ for
> the vid/pid of my mouse.
> 
> So i am trying to trace down the code that decides the driver to
> assign to the device. I have gone from usb_register in
> drivers/usb/core/usb.c, as far back as bus_add_driver in
> drivers/base/bus.c, but i'm afraid this is where i get lost. Could
> somebody just give me some pointers as to the code in the usb
> subsystem that really takes care of this, that decides which driver to
> assign to which interface?
> 
> i would really appreciate some help here,
> thanks,
> -jf

Look in drivers/usb/core/usb.c at the usb_device_match() and 
usb_match_id() functions.
